Construction of an Immune-Related Six-lncRNA Signature to Predict the Outcomes, Immune Cell Infiltration, and Immunotherapy Response in Patients With Hepatocellular Carcinoma

BackgroundHepatocellular carcinoma (HCC) is one of the world’s most lethal malignant tumors with a poor prognosis.
